Amazon.com:
Things blow up. Someone you think is a human turns out to be a shape-shifting Terminator. There are confusing forays through time and discussions about what happened when in which version of the past and/or future. But really, the second season of Terminator: The Sarah Connor Chronicles--unfortunately the final season of the series--is about family, connections, and the things we do to protect the ones we love. Sarah Connor (Lena Headey) has an especially rough road, nearly dying and becoming obsessed with a three-dot symbol and detours through a world of UFO obsessives. John Connor (Thomas Dekker), a.k.a. the guy who will grow up to lead humanity's resistance to the hated machines, gets tough and gets a girlfriend. His uncle Derek (Brian Austin Green) gets a girl as well, and the women in their lives turn out to have a surprising connection. Cameron (Summer Glau), the Terminator sent to protect John, suffers some damage and reveals some surprisingly human secrets of her own as her relationship with John gets more emotional and complicated. Shirley Manson (lead singer of Garbage) joins the cast as Catherine Weaver, an icy executive with… well, suffice it to say that a familiar (and threatening) face shows up in her company. The special features are extensive and include featurettes on the writing, effects, stunts, music and more. This is a fitting sendoff for an ambitious show. --Stephanie Reid-Simons

Rating: 5 out of 5 stars - Subtitle madness
I really like this show, it's the best since the Terminator 2 movie. The only thing I don't understand is why the Blu-ray doesn't have portuguese subtitles, since Brazil and USA are in the same Blu-ray region (region A), on the other hand the DVD version of the same product has portuguese subtitles and remember that, unlike blu-ray, DVDs from USA and Brazil have different region numbers (1 and 4 respectively). I already noticed the same problem with Fringe and Smallville, I think that a blu-ray disc should have all the subtitles related to the region of the disc. Other than that I love this show, 5 stars.
